The annual total crime rate in Waipāwa is 39.2157 crimes per thousand residents, placing it at rank 39 within Hawke's Bay Region. The overall crime trend in the area has decreased in recent months with criminal activity peaking in May 2022, September 2023, April 2024.

Offence breakdown · past 12 months

Based on total incidents. Updated October 2025.
  • Theft 48.2%

  • Burglary 36.2%

  • Assault 10.2%

  • Robbery, Blackmail, And Extortion 3.0%

  • Sexual Offences 2.1%

  • Harm Or Endanger Persons 0.3%
